1. Who You Should Invite

Destination weddings are naturally more intimate — which is perfect for the bride who wants a celebration with the people who truly matter.
Most couples invite close family and their inner circle of friends — the ones who bring joy, not stress.

👉 On average, 60–75% of invited guests attend. This helps you keep expectations realistic and your guest list beautifully intentional.

 
2. Who Pays for What

Here’s the part every busy bride wants to know — and it’s simpler than you think.
Guests typically cover their own:
  • Flights
  • Hotel stay
  • Personal expenses

Couples usually host the meaningful moments: 
✨ Welcome party
 ✨ Group activities 
✨ Wedding day events

Think of it as you hosting the experience, not paying for everyone’s trip. It keeps things elegant, manageable, and stress‑free.

3. How Far in Advance to Plan

For the bride who loves convenience and hates last‑minute chaos, the sweet spot is 12–18 months.

Planning early gives you: 
✔ Better resort and venue availability 
✔ Better pricing and perks 
✔ More time for guests to budget and prepare
It’s the easiest way to keep everything smooth, organized, and aligned with your lifestyle — so you can focus on your career, your life, and the parts of wedding planning you actually enjoy.

 
4. When to Send Invitations
 
Timing is everything — especially for a bride who wants a smooth, stress‑free planning experience.

Save‑the‑Dates (Your Most Important Step)
Picture
Send 12–15 months before your wedding. This gives your guests time to plan, budget, and request PTO without scrambling.
Include:

  • Wedding date + destination
  • Resort or location details
  • Wedding website link
  • RSVP or interest form

Think of this as your planning hub, not just an announcement. It sets the tone for your entire wedding experience.

 
Formal Invitations (Details + Experience)
Picture
Send 3–4 months before the wedding. This is where you share the fun, curated details: 
✨ Full itinerary 
✨ Event times 
✨ Dress codes 
✨ Travel reminders
These invitations prepare your guests, not inform them for the first time — big difference.

7. Average Cost of a Destination Wedding

For Mexico and the Caribbean, most weddings fall between $10,000–$30,000+.
Your final cost depends on:
  • Guest count
  • Resort
  • Package
  • Customizations

Think of it like choosing a luxury handbag — the range is wide, but the value comes from choosing what fits your style, your priorities, and the experience you want to create.

 
8. What Travel Requirements Should Guests Know

Your guests want the experience to feel effortless — and early guidance makes all the difference.
They should plan for: 
✔ A valid passport 
✔ Travel timelines (especially during busy seasons) 
✔ Optional travel insurance

Sharing this information early keeps everything smooth, organized, and stress‑free for everyone — especially for guests who love convenience just as much as you do.
